Overview of Cisco Webex

The Cisco Webex API allows developers to integrate their applications with Cisco's robust collaboration tools, creating a workflow of communication within teams and automating various aspects of the meeting lifecycle, from scheduling to follow-up actions. With this API, you can streamline meeting setups, fetch detailed information about participants and meetings, send messages to spaces (rooms), and manage your Webex resources programmatically. Leveraging Pipedream's capabilities, you can connect these features with other apps to automate complex tasks, analyze meeting data, enhance productivity, and maintain a well-organized communication ecosystem.

import { axios } from "@pipedream/platform"
export default defineComponent({
  props: {
    cisco_webex: {
      type: "app",
      app: "cisco_webex",
    }
  },
  async run({steps, $}) {
    return await axios($, {
      url: `https://webexapis.com/v1/people/me`,
      headers: {
        Authorization: `Bearer ${this.cisco_webex.$auth.oauth_access_token}`,
      },
    })
  },
})

Overview of Twilio

Twilio's API on Pipedream opens up a multitude of communication capabilities, allowing you to build robust, scalable, and automated workflows. With Twilio, you can send and receive SMS and MMS messages, make voice calls, and perform other communication functions programmatically. Leveraging Pipedream's seamless integration, you can connect these communications features with hundreds of other services to automate notifications, streamline customer interactions, and enhance operational efficiency.

import { axios } from "@pipedream/platform"
export default defineComponent({
  props: {
    twilio: {
      type: "app",
      app: "twilio",
    }
  },
  async run({steps, $}) {
    return await axios($, {
      url: `https://api.twilio.com/2010-04-01/Accounts.json`,
      auth: {
        username: `${this.twilio.$auth.AccountSid}`,
        password: `${this.twilio.$auth.AuthToken}`,
      },
    })
  },
})

How Our Family Uses SMS and Smart Picture Frames to Connect During Remote Holidays
Two days before Thanksgiving, I decided to put together a simple way for our family to share pictures, because we couldn’t be together in person. The idea: smart photo frames that everyone could text pictures to. Here’s how I got it working. tldr; A Pipedream workflow parses SMS messages sent to a Twilio phone number, extracting the pictures and then using SendGrid to email them to the dedicated email addresses used by our Pix-Star photo frames.
